NordVPN and Surfshark are two of the most popular consumer VPNs, and they're now owned by the same parent company (Nord Security). Despite the shared ownership, they remain distinct products targeting different audiences: NordVPN focuses on premium security features, while Surfshark competes aggressively on price and device limits.
We tested both VPNs over 30 days across multiple locations and devices, measuring speed, streaming reliability, and real-world usability. Here's how they compare.

Speed
NordVPN is the faster VPN in our tests. Using its proprietary NordLynx protocol (built on WireGuard), we consistently recorded download speeds above 850 Mbps on a 1 Gbps connection when connecting to nearby servers. Even long-distance connections (US to Europe) maintained 400–500 Mbps, which is more than enough for any consumer use case.
Surfshark is no slouch either. Its WireGuard implementation delivered around 780 Mbps on local connections and 350–450 Mbps on international routes. The gap is noticeable in benchmarks but unlikely to matter in daily use unless you're regularly transferring large files or need peak gaming performance.
Security Protocols
NordVPN's standout security feature is NordLynx, its custom protocol built on the WireGuard framework with an additional double NAT system to address WireGuard's inherent privacy concerns. The company has also invested heavily in RAM-only servers (no data written to disk), Threat Protection (blocking malware, trackers, and ads), and Meshnet (private encrypted networking between your own devices).
Surfshark offers WireGuard, IKEv2, and OpenVPN protocols. Its CleanWeb feature blocks ads and trackers, and the MultiHop option routes your traffic through two VPN servers for added anonymity. Surfshark also runs RAM-only servers and has passed independent no-logs audits by Deloitte.
Both VPNs are headquartered in privacy-friendly jurisdictions (NordVPN in Panama, Surfshark in the Netherlands under the company's BV entity), and both have been independently audited multiple times.
Server Network
NordVPN has the larger network: over 6,400 servers across 111 countries. This matters most for finding fast nearby servers and for accessing geo-restricted content from less common locations. NordVPN also offers specialty servers for P2P traffic, double VPN, onion-over-VPN, and dedicated IP addresses.
Surfshark covers 100 countries with 3,200+ servers. While smaller, the coverage includes all the major regions. Surfshark also offers static IP servers and MultiHop configurations.
Streaming
Both VPNs reliably unblock major streaming platforms, but NordVPN has a slight edge in consistency. In our testing, NordVPN successfully accessed Netflix (US, UK, Japan, Australia), Disney+, BBC iPlayer, Hulu, Amazon Prime Video, and HBO Max on the first server attempt in most cases.
Surfshark also unblocked all the same services, but we occasionally needed to switch servers to find one that worked with certain platforms. The experience was still good — just required an extra step now and then.
Pricing
Surfshark is the clear winner on price. Its 2-year plan comes to approximately $2.29/month, making it one of the cheapest premium VPNs available. NordVPN's 2-year plan costs around $3.49/month for the Standard tier.
NordVPN offers three tiers: Standard (VPN only), Plus (adds Threat Protection Pro and password manager), and Ultimate (adds 1 TB encrypted cloud storage and breach monitoring). The Plus plan at around $4.49/month is the most popular option.
Surfshark offers Starter, One (adds antivirus and alerts), and One+ (adds data removal service). Its One plan at roughly $3.19/month matches NordVPN's Standard pricing.
Device Limits
This is Surfshark's biggest advantage. It allows unlimited simultaneous device connections on a single account. You can protect every device in your household — phones, laptops, tablets, smart TVs, routers — without worrying about limits.
NordVPN allows 10 simultaneous connections, which increased from 6 in recent years. Ten devices is enough for most individuals, but families or users with many devices will appreciate Surfshark's unlimited policy.

Our Verdict
Choose NordVPN if: You want the fastest speeds, the largest server network, and premium security features like Threat Protection and Meshnet. NordVPN is the better VPN overall, especially for streaming and security-conscious users.
Choose Surfshark if: Budget is your top priority, you need unlimited device connections, or you're looking for a family VPN that everyone can use without managing device slots.
Our pick: NordVPN wins on performance and features. Surfshark wins on value. For most individual users, NordVPN's Standard plan offers the best balance. For families or budget shoppers, Surfshark is hard to beat.
